Alphawave Semi enables tomorrow’s future by accelerating the critical data communication at the heart of our digital world – from seamless video streaming to AI to the metaverse and much more. Our technology powers product innovation in the most data-demanding industries today, including data centers, networking, storage, artificial intelligence, 5G wireless infrastructure, and autonomous vehicles. Customers partner with us for mission-critical data communication, our innovative technologies, and our proven track record. Together, we enable the next generation of digital technology.

  • As a member of Alphawave Semi’s Connectivity Products Group, you will help enable the next generation of datacenter interconnects by driving the development of direct detect and Coherent DSP products supporting 800Gbps, 1.6Tbps and beyond interconnects spanning a few millimeters to a few hundred kilometers.

Senior/Staff/Principal, Product Applications Engineer 

As a member of Alphawave Semi’s Product Applications and Systems Engineering team, you are responsible for delivering 1st line technical support to customers designing with our state-of-the-art DSP chips. In this role, you will ensure timely responses in enabling, configuring and integrating Alphawave Products into the customer’s designs. In addition, you will regularly engage with internal R&D team to provide customer application specific expertise to improve our product offerings. 

What You’ll Do 

  • Drive technical communication with customers from kickoff to Production ramp of customer designs, coordinating with internal R&D teams as necessary. 
  • Author Data Sheets, Product Briefs, User guides and Application notes to enable customers to successfully design with our products or address specific design considerations.
  • Support the design of evaluation boards and reference design kits representative of customer applications.
  • Validate performance of our products in representative applications.
  • Diagnose, debug, and resolve issues during bring-up and validation of customer designs using our products.
  • Occasional travel is required 

What You’ll Need 

  • Bachelor's and/or Master's degree in Electrical and/or Electronic Engineering, Computer Engineering or Computer Science
  • Minimum of 5 years relevant experience which can include board level design, optical module design, or Applications Engineering
  • Domain knowledge of high-speed interconnects and technologies including DSPs and/or optics for PAM4 and/or Coherent transmission
  • Experience with debug and troubleshooting of firmware and hardware issues with high-speed DSPs, optical components and optoelectronic components and optical modules

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
